On Friday I loaded the egg up with about 85% WG Competition blend, 15% Royal Oak up to near the top of fire ring. Started the fire at 5:00 PM, cooked two 7.5 pound butts until 10:00 AM Saturday, kept fire going and put on 3 slabs of ribs at noon, took them off at 5:30, put a pot of baked beans on at 6:00 and took them off at 7:30. That's 26 1/2 hours of continual use! I stirred the lump today to remove ashes and to see how much lump I had left and here is the result :[p]LongBurnLeftovers.jpg
